WebGenerally Steel beam size represented by dimensions of web × flange × weight per unit length, measured in mm or inch such as size of steel beam ismb150 represented as 150 × 75 or 6″×3″, where 150mm is depth of steel beam, 75mm is their flange width. Variation among the universal beam include material, length of the web and depth of flanges.

WebBeam - A measure of the width of the ship. There are two types: Beam, Overall (BOA), commonly referred to simply as Beam - The overall width of the ship measured at the widest point of the nominal waterline. Beam on Centerline (BOC) - Used for multihull vessels. The BOC for vessels is measured as follows: For a catamaran: the …

According to the ISO 11146 standard, the BPP is given by the product of the beam radius (measured at the beam waist) and the half-angle beam divergence (measured in the far field). dgme chattisgarhWeb15 sep. 2016 · The D86 method of beam width measurement uses a power enclosure, rather than the profile of the beam to determine the beam width. To calculate the width of the beam with the D86 method, a circle (see Fig. 1a) or ellipse (see Fig. 1b) is first found which encloses 86.5% of the total power across the sensor.
